自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 收藏
  • 关注

原创 国产Linux系统,麒麟V10SP1、ARM架构平台升级最新版OpenSSH-9.6p1教程

两种方式本人都亲自测试过,都能升级成功!祝大家也能升级成功!

2024-03-19 22:34:37 2019 2

原创 mybatis-plus的包冲突问题

mybatis-plus跟mybatis-plus-generator共用会报错的问题

2022-02-18 17:17:43 1185

原创 mysql权限管理数据备份日志

mysql权限管理:1)权限相关概念用户 -> 权限登录权限资源权限2)权限表 mysql -> user 复合主键 Host(主机名) -> 确定能访问的主机 User(用户名) 权限属性 PRIVILEGES SELECT_priv -> 枚举 enum('N','Y') INSERT_priv UPDATE_priv DELETE_priv CREATE_priv 锁定属性 a

2021-08-18 20:07:43 101

原创 mysql函数

mysql常用函数:字符串​ CHAR_LENGTH() 截取字符串字符长度 注意:字符和字节(环境格式)区分​ SUBSTRING() 截取子字符串 注意:下标从1开始数字​ ROUND() 四舍五入 注意:负数 舍弃整数部分日期时间​ NOW() 当前日期时间​ CURRENT_DATE() 当前日期​ CURRENT_TIME() 当前时间​ CURRENT_TIMESTAMP() 当前日期时间​ DATE_FORMAT() 指定时间格式 %y%m%d%h %i%s

2021-08-18 20:07:16 78

原创 mysql基本语法

创建数据库语法CREATE DATABASE [IF NOT EXISTS] 数据库名[DEFAULT CHARACTER SET utf8][DEFAULT COLLATE utf8_bin];删除数据库语法DROP DATABASE [IF EXISTS] 数据库名定位数据库语法USE 数据库名;创建表语法:CREATE TABLE 【IF NOT EXISITS】 表名 { 列名 数据类型 【约束】, 列名 数据类型 【约束】, 列名 数据类型 【约束】

2021-08-18 20:06:32 97

原创 数据库基本概念

数据库实体:1、数据库 Database DB2、表 Table3、索引 Index(***)4、事务 Transaction(***)5、锁 Lock6、视图 View7、过程 Procedure8、触发器 TriggerT-SQL语法(***)1、DDL 数据定义语言(data definition language)​ create 创建​ alter 更改​ drop 移除​ truncate 截断2、DML 数据操作语言(data manipulate lan

2021-08-18 20:02:11 68

原创 运算符号的

运算符号位运算符:把一个数字变成二进制位来进行运算原码:一个数字的二进制结果正数的原反补码全部一样负数:负数的反码=原码的符号位不变,其他各位取反1 0000011 原码 -31 1111100 反码 -3的负数的补码=反码+1,符号位不变1 1111101 补码 -3计算机一般使用补码来进行运算位非: ~ 对补码各位取反,包括符号位-71 00001111 1111000 反1 1111001 补 对补码运算0 0000110 +6100 00001010 正数的原反补相

2021-08-15 16:53:41 69

原创 异常的常规

异常1.异常的分类异常:程序出现了不可预料的走向或结果。Exception错误:Error,是由JVM来管理的,是致命的,编程者干预不了的。运行时的Exception是未检查的,也就是编译器在写完的时候并不会报红线,但是在运行的时候控制台就会出现错误。在程序编写和编译期间可以不用处理的异常。是从RuntimeException下继承而来的。非运行时Exception是检查的,也就是你还没运行的时候就出现了报红线,并且会阻止运行。在编译时必须显示的做出异常的处理才能继续下去。2.处理异常两种处

2021-08-15 16:52:31 79

原创 数据类型和变量

数据类型和变量按照内存大小来分:(一个字节8位)1个字节:byte boolean2个字节:char short4个字节:int float8个字节:long doublebyte -> short -> int -> long 向后兼容[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-vHc1bHpb-1629017407843)(C:\Users\24629\AppData\Roaming\Typora\typora-u

2021-08-15 16:50:22 68

原创 构造方法和this

构造方法语法:方法名称必须与类名相同且无返回类型这一栏public class A{​ public A(){​ }//默认的空参构造方法}作用:用于创建这个类型的对象。构造方法可以有一个或N个。构造方法在用户未定义的时候,默认有一个公共无参的。this关键词在每个类中,都有个隐式对象,叫做this,代表此类的当前实例。可以在每个非静态方法中使用(静态方法中不允许使用this指针)this可以点出来当前对象所有的属性和方法。本类内 的 属性本类内 的 方法()...

2021-08-15 16:49:52 59

原创 封装类和枚举

封装类基本数据类型的数据,不是对象。所以提供了一些类型,可以将对应的基本类型数据,包装成对象。byte Byteboolean Booleanchar Charactershort Shortint Integerfloat Floatlong Longdouble Double拆箱和装箱int a = new Integer(3);//自动拆箱Integer x = 4;//自动装箱枚举类型enum: 将所有的数据列举出现,让使用者只能从这里选择。pub

2021-08-15 16:49:20 134

原创 按钮事件监听和常用组件

事件监听单击事件监听,需要先实现ActionListener接口。事件监听器的对象,必须是ActionListener接口的对象,即:先实现这个接口,实现它的方法。public class MainFrame extends JFrame implements ActionListener{​ //需要实现的方法​ @Override​ public void actionPerformed(ActionEvent e){​​ }}然后对按钮对象进行注册监听:ActionList

2021-08-15 16:48:24 265

原创 super和重写、接口、抽象

super()super 调用父类的方法super() 调用父类默认无参的构造方法super().方法名() 调用父类中定义的方法,也可能是父类的祖宗类提供的方法重写:重写发生在子类继承父类之后重写的原则:子类的访问修饰符要大于等于父类的修饰符,且除了方法形参名以外,什么都不能改。终态(final):final:修饰一个类、方法、变量、对象类修饰final:表示此类不能被继承方法final:表示该方法不能被子类重写变量final:表示此变量不能改值或引用。但必须赋值初始化常量:即是

2021-08-15 16:45:28 188

原创 String、StringBuild、StringBuffer

1.StringString代表的是字符串类型,特点是不可擦写,即不可更改。String s1 = “abc”;​ s1 = “def”;这个不叫做更改,这个叫做重新引用字符串对象拥有的常用的方法:长度: length() 返回字符串的字符个数;截取单个字符: charAt(i) 取出第i位的字符(i的值不能为负数或者超过范围)截取一段内容: substring(start,end) 从start开始,到end结束,不包含end​ substring(start) 从star

2021-08-15 16:44:52 141

原创 java一个字符判断scanner

Java输入一个字符并判断Scanner sc = new Scanner(System.in);String s = sc.nextLine();char grade = s.charAt(0);//这样就可以拿到一个输入的字符next():以空格为结束符nextLine():以回车作为结束符,可以获得空白。scanner.close();//关闭输入流的资源释放内存空间判断输入是否有下一个:while (scanner.hasNextDouble()){ d

2021-08-15 16:41:27 189

原创 MarkDown学习

MarkDown学习标题:(推荐使用Typora)二级标题 ##+标题名字(以此类推)字体hello world! 黑体左右两边两个*号hello world! 斜体左右三个*号hello world! 删除体左右两个~hello world!引用引用别人的东西加>符号分割线三个*或者三个-图片![]加括号[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-DUAbZBlF-1625297155635)(C:\Users\24629\Deskt

2021-07-03 15:29:24 47

原创 6-1 数组元素的区间删除

6-1 数组元素的区间删除给定一个顺序存储的线性表,请设计一个函数删除所有值大于min而且小于max的元素。删除后表中剩余元素保持顺序存储,并且相对位置不能改变。函数接口定义:int Delete( int A[], int L, int minA, int maxA );其中A是整型数组,存储原始线性表的元素;L是表长,即A中元素的个数;minA和maxA分别为待删除元素的值域的下、上界...

2019-11-01 13:25:40 767

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除